In 'Gabriel,' S. Kohn masterfully weaves a rich tapestry of human emotion and moral ambiguity, exploring the intricate dynamics between faith, identity, and the quest for redemption. The narrative unfolds through a unique blend of lyrical prose and vivid imagery, inviting readers into a poignant exploration of the titular character, Gabriel, who grapples with his past while navigating the complexities of relationships in a changing world. Kohn's literary style reflects a postmodern sensibility, skillfully intertwining elements of allegory and realism, making 'Gabriel' both an evocative and thought-provoking read that resonates with contemporary issues of belonging and existential inquiry. S. Kohn, an accomplished author with a background in theology and philosophy, draws inspiration from both personal experiences and broader societal narratives. Their deep understanding of spiritual dilemmas and human connections infuses the novel with authenticity and depth. Kohn's previous works often tackle themes of faith and identity, making 'Gabriel' a culmination of their literary exploration into the human condition amidst the quest for meaning in an increasingly fragmented world. This book is highly recommended for readers who appreciate literary works that challenge societal norms and delve deep into the psyche of their characters. 'Gabriel' is a compelling read for anyone interested in the intersection of faith and identity, and it will linger long in the minds of those who encounter its beautifully crafted narrative.
